About

NEW Luxury doorman building with 1200 SF, two bedroom, two full baths, KEYED ELEVATOR and gym. The apartment features open chef's kitchen including top-of-the-line stainless steel appliances, granite counter-tops, wine-cooler refrigerator.

The rest of the apartment has beautiful hardwood floor, two king-size bedrooms, walk-in closets, extra storage spaces, WASHER/DRYER, high ceilings and the apartment is pleasantly quiet.

Flatiron is a historic New York City neighborhood that has seen its fair share of change over the years. In the early 1900s, it was a major commercial and residential center. By the middle of the century, things stagnated as businesses and residents left in search of more space and lower rents. In recent years, stores, upscale restaurants, and new developments moved back in, and the neighborhood is seeing a significant resurgence. Fifth Avenue now bustles with some of the best shopping in the city, and restaurants run the gamut from Michelin-rated to Yelp-reviewed food trucks.

Flatiron is busiest at midday and cocktail hour and tends to quiet down a bit at night, although the lights never truly turn off. Proximity to Union Square and multiple subway lines make it an equally easy trip to Midtown or Downtown.
